Switching 18V

If it is acceptable to common the grounds of the Arduino and the door release power supply, then you don't need a relay, you can use a BJT such as BC327 to switch the current to the door release directly. See Arduino Playground - HomePage.

If you can't common the grounds, then I would still switch the door lock with a BJT instead of a relay, but I would use an opto isolator to drive the BJT.